Jean Baptiste Recollect Trading Post

Muskegon County · dedicated 1980 · 310 Ruddiman Drive, North Muskegon

Near this site, on the shore of Muskegon Lake, stood the first Indian fur trading post in Muskegon County. It was established in 1812 by Jean Baptiste Recollect, a French fur trader believed to be this area’s first white settler. Jean Recollect remained here for about a year when a new manager took over. The Muskegon post operated as a successful business enterprise for many years. Remains of the chimney of Recollect’s station were visible as late as 1836.
